The Growth of Wrexham AFC
Wrexham AFC, under the ownership of Ryan Reynolds and Rob McElhenney, has seen unprecedented success both on and off the pitch. The club’s rapid rise through the divisions, culminating in three successive promotions, has been paralleled by its global commercial success driven by the Disney+ series, Welcome to Wrexham.
What started as a £2 million investment in 2021 has now skyrocketed to a valuation of £100-136 million in 2024, with a target of £350 million by December 2025. This places Wrexham in the same league as established Premier League clubs, making it a top-tier financial asset.
The Strategic Purpose of Apollo’s Investment
The partnership with Apollo Global Management is not just about injecting capital into the club; it’s about setting the foundation for long-term growth and success. Apollo’s investment is designed to provide patient capital for infrastructure development, including the redevelopment of the stadium and facilities.
With over £32 million already invested by the owners towards growth, the next phase, which includes reaching the Premier League, requires a significant leap in operational funding. Apollo’s involvement not only bridges this financial gap but also sets Wrexham on course to achieve its ultimate goal of Premier League status.
Commercial Success and Global Branding
One of the key strengths of the Wrexham model is its ability to generate revenue beyond its league status. The club’s commercial success has been extraordinary, with total turnover growing by 155% to £26.7 million in the 2023-24 season.
Global sponsorships from companies like United Airlines, HP, Gatorade, and MetaQuest have been instrumental in expanding Wrexham’s reach and attracting a global fanbase. The strategic play to conquer the US market has already shown promising results, with more than half of the club’s turnover generated internationally.
